Dead Man Was Beaten With Crutch: Cops

Police said a fight between two homeless men led to a slaying

A 21-year-old homeless man has been charged in the beating and stabbing of another homeless man whose body was found in an abandoned factory building in Waterbury, police said.

Police found the body of Joed Olivera, 39, around 1 p.m. Thursday inside the South Main Street building that used to house the Waterbury Companies Inc. Police believe that Olivera was beaten with his own crutch.

The victim had been living in the building and police said the killing apparently came after an argument between the men.

Shortly after finding Olivera’s body, police arrested Matthew O'Brien-Veader.
